Domiciliary Branch Manager
An amazing opportunity has arisen for a dedicated Registered Manager - Homecare Service in the Central, London area. In this role, you will be responsible for delivering high-quality client care, ensuring efficient service operations, and demonstrating strong organisational skills. This position is ideal for someone who is passionate about making a positive difference in people's lives
This is a high-quality home care service dedicated to helping individuals live independent and fulfilling lives in the comfort of their own homes. Services include short visits as well as 24-hour complex care and support
As the Registered Manager your key responsibilities include:
- Act as the CQC-registered individual for the service, ensuring full compliance with all regulatory requirements
- Establish strong, professional relationships with all stakeholders including service users, their families, local authority, hospitals, commissioning teams, district nurses, therapists and GP's
- Lead on safeguarding, incidents, complaints, and quality assurance monitoring
- Raising, reporting, responding and investigation of complaints, concerns and feedback received through the correct channels in line with company policies and procedures
- Drive a culture of safe, effective, and person-centred care across the service
- Maintain oversight of audits, care standards, and ensure inspection readiness
- Monitor service performance, identifying risks and implementing improvements
- Ensure robust governance frameworks are embedded
- Provide leadership and strategic direction to the wider management team
- Report writing including governance and data updates
The following skills and experience would be preferred and beneficial for the role:
- Strong working knowledge of CQC regulations, inspections, and quality frameworks
- Demonstrated ability to lead large teams and services at scale
- Confident in managing safeguarding, complaints, and risk
- Strong leadership presence with the ability to influence and develop teams
- Commercial awareness and understanding of service growth and sustainability
You should hold an NVQ/QCF Level 5 in Health & Social Care or working towards this + Proven experience as a Registered Manager within Homecare
